Summary: “Group Minds,” Doris Lessing

Summary: “Group Minds,” Doris Lessing


In her article “Group Minds,” Doris Lessing stated that it is human nature to want to belong to a group, so we often conform to the group’s way of thinking, for that reason we must use the knowledge we have about human behavior to “set us free” as individual thinkers.
